如何在带有 nuxt 的 vuetify 插件中使用 roboto 字体提高页面速度

How to improve page speed with roboto font in vuetify plugin with nuxt

当我做灯塔报告时,这个性能问题出现在 Eliminate render-blocking resources 来自 url /css?family=Roboto:100,300,400,500,700,900&display=swap 它是由 vuetify 框架和 nuxt 生成的,我怎么能不阻止这个渲染?

默认情况下,vuetifyRoboto 字体和 MDI 图标添加到您的项目,从同步脚本外部加载它在头部。它会导致您的项目在其他所有内容之前加载它们,从而使您的页面加载大约延迟 1 秒。

您可以通过将以下内容添加到您的 nuxt.config.js 文件来关闭它:

vuetify: {
    defaultAssets: false
}

来源: 在 Whosebug 上。